Out-of-bounds access via unchecked AFS metadata
Published Sep 16, 2026 · Updated Sep 16, 2026
Improper input validation in the Linux kernel AFS v2 parser allows attackers to trigger out-of-bounds memory access via crafted flash metadata. The afs_parse_v2_partition function subtracts footer[8] from erase-block bounds and walks region_count entries in a fixed imginfo array without validating either flash-controlled value. Reachability requires an MTD device containing attacker-controlled AFS v2 image data to be parsed; the public patch does not state a further impact.
